Output 58f109b69ae3024f0c96e36da18859882e2aa9ac749f3695973e2a0c497c1ca9:1

value
2296819
script pubkey
OP_0 OP_PUSHBYTES_20 79e33e9f5e1b37be503989bb30955665c5c4e2fe
address
bc1q083na867rvmmu5pe3xanp92kvhzufch7xqugzu
transaction
58f109b69ae3024f0c96e36da18859882e2aa9ac749f3695973e2a0c497c1ca9
spent
true